Transaction e76f4062c6074d0361b6430fae9b936f2c80974ca6ab146985496f2a4402da64

2 Input
2 Outputs
  • e76f4062c6074d0361b6430fae9b936f2c80974ca6ab146985496f2a4402da64:0
  • value  2722137
    address  34dcUF7rtsTjSN4JMPHBAWhY2uKe5n8YVx
  • e76f4062c6074d0361b6430fae9b936f2c80974ca6ab146985496f2a4402da64:1
  • value  53724
    address  37Y1b3aL8womkCRq7mRM6jx45js3JcifoR